Knights Ferry is good for a day hike, picnic, and overall relaxing by the river. During summer months they offer river rafting, but you can also use your own raft and float down the river. There are hiking trails that you can follow that are fairly easy to moderate at some points. The North side of the river is the most popular trail and is more worn. There is more to explore on the North trail, and good luck if you try to conquer the steep hill. The trail on the South side of the river is less traveled but there are many traveling paths to choose from. This side is more secluded and a lot more green. If you park in the (first) upper lot, it will take you directly to the South side of the river, just follow the trail on the back side of the lot to the covered bridge. This appears to be wheelchair accessible. There’s not a whole lot to see on the South side, and only a few tight areas to reach the river. There is a restroom along the North trail, but word to the wise - use the restroom at the visitor center. There are two parking lots (an upper and lower lot). The cost is $5 which is paid with a credit card. The kiosk does not accept cash. Knights Ferry has two dine in restaurants, both of which are pretty good. There’s a 50’s themed restaurant at the start of the entrance to Knights Ferry, and the Rivers Edge restaurant when you get to the bottom of the hill (take a left). We visited Nights Ferry back October 2020 and what a fun day it was. We parked in the parking lot at the recreation area which had a kiosk for parking tickets so don't worry about needing to buy one before hand. The rec area has a cool informational building which unfortunately is closed due to Covid. It also has tables with BBQ pits near by next to the river for a great swimming experience  and I will note that the water at this time was a bit too cold. Take a walk past the informational center and you'll make it to the old flour mill turned hydroelectric station and take a look back into the past with the fun informational booths they have located around the buildings. Once you make it past that you'll come to the bridge which gave my kids the biggest smile to be walking through as they shouted "Echo"! On the other side of the bridge you'll see to the immediate left is a trail down to the side of the river but beware it is a bit steep and slippery. Continue on past the bridge and to the right is more tables and BBQ pits shaded under the trees next to the somewhat steep beach by the river(gorgeous clear water!). There is also another parking lot next to this location btw. Don’t skip this hidden gem on the way to Yosemite 👇 
Wild lupines are popping right now, and this spot is peak spring magic. Before I drop my top Yosemite hidden gem guides, I had to feature one of my favorite pit stops. Trail Guide: 
🥾 Stanislaus River Trail 
📍 Knights Ferry Recreation Area 
💵 $10/car (they do ticket) 
⛰️ Easy – 3.2 mi out & back, 200 ft gain 
🧒 Kid-friendly ♿ Not wheelchair accessible 🐕 friendly: Yes on leash 🚽: In parking lot Pro Tips:
• Morning = best light
• Lupines are tucked away (blog coming soon!)
• Wear long pants (ticks!)
• Bring water
